Title: Telecom Cable Laying Cost Standard
The Telecom Cable Laying Cost Standard is a document that outlines the costs and procedures related to the installation of telecommunications cables. It is typically used by cable operators and network providers to ensure consistency and transparency in their operations. The standard specifies the costs associated with various stages of cable installation, such as cable burial, cable jointing, and cable testing. It also includes provisions for additional costs related to factors such as depth of burial, length of cable route, and complexity of installation. By following this standard, cable operators and network providers can ensure that their operations are cost-effective and comply with industry regulations.

1. Types of Communication Cables
Firstly, there are several different types of communication cables, each with its own specific use and cost. The most common types include coaxial cables, fiber optic cables, and twisted pair cables. Coaxial cables, which are often used for television and internet connections, are relatively easy to install but may not offer the same level of performance as more modern cables. Fiber optic cables, on the other hand, provide much higher speeds and are often used for business and high-performance internet applications. Twisted pair cables are commonly used for telephone lines and are generally less expensive to install than coaxial or fiber optic cables.
2. Distance to be Covered
The cost of laying communication cables also depends on the distance to be covered. Longer distances require more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ost of the project. Additionally, long-distance cables are more prone to damage and require more frequent maintenance, further driving up costs. However, with advancements in technology, it is now possible to lay longer cables with fewer problems and at a lower cost.
3. Terrain being Traversed
Another significant factor affecting the cost of communication cable installation is the terrain being traversed. Laying cables in mountainous or hilly areas can be much more challenging and expensive than in flat areas. This is because such terrain often requires more sophisticated equipment and techniques to ensure that the cables are properly laid and remain functional over time. Moreover, such projects also take longer to complete, further increasing labor costs.
4. Other Factors Affecting Cost
In addition to the above factors, there are several other considerations that can affect the final cost of communication cable installation. These include the need for additional equipment such as cable trays or ducts, the type of grounding system required, and the cost of any necessary permits or licenses. These extra costs can quickly add up, making it essential for planners and budget holders to carefully consider all relevant factors when estimating the total cost of a project.
